1. Three parameters changed on January 1

On January 1, 2026, on a test rig at an equipment lab in Florida, a technician loaded three parameters into the standard distance test: 125 mph clubhead speed, 11 degrees of launch, 2,200 rpm of spin. Previously the same test ran at 120 mph, 10 degrees and 2,520 rpm.

The Overall Distance Standard stayed at 317 yards while the test conditions were tightened. A ball that passed the old standard can fall outside the new one. For the fastest players, the distance taken away sits between 13 and 15 yards, depending on launch angle and strike pattern.

Fifteen yards. On a major course, fifteen yards is the gap between an 8-iron and a 9-iron in a high-speed player's hands. It is the line between a birdie hole and a par hole. It is the difference between a wedge that stops and a wedge that has to be cut high to hold.

3. Technical layer: strokes gained after distance is taken away

3.1 Who loses most. The distance removed is not distributed evenly. A player at 120 mph and 11 degrees loses 13 to 15 yards. A player at 105 mph and 13 degrees may lose fewer than 5, or nothing meaningful. The rule works as a progressive tax on speed — and the tax is heavier on flatter launch conditions.

Two consequences follow. First, the absolute value of Strokes Gained: Off the Tee falls across the system. When everyone gets shorter, the gap between the longest and the shortest narrows. Over the past 20 years, the spread between the tour's driving-distance leader and the tour average has sat between 35 and 40 yards. A 13-to-15-yard tax on the top group could compress that below 30 yards within 18 to 24 months. Second, the relative value of Strokes Gained: Approach rises. From a shorter ball, approaches come from half a club to a full club longer. Players with strong approach numbers absorb the change better than players who relied on hitting it close enough to wedge in.

3.2 Three technical profiles. Profile A wins with speed: distance off the tee, short clubs in hand, chances converted. Scheffler sits here but differs because his approach numbers never depended on how far he hit it. Bryson DeChambeau sits in the purest form of this profile. Profile B wins with ball flight: approach and around-the-green strength without maximum distance. Collin Morikawa, Hideki Matsuyama and most Korean and Japanese tour players sit here. For them the rule is an indirect boost, because it lowers the peer baseline. Profile C wins on the greens with putting and green-reading, the highest-variance group in the data and the most mispriced by models.

3.3 Course variables. PGA Championship 2026 goes to Aronimink Golf Club (May 14–17), with small, tiered, heavily sloped greens. US Open 2026 goes to Shinnecock Hills (June 18–21), where history shows greens can pass the threshold of control when wind picks up. The Open 2026 goes to Royal Birkdale (July 16–19), a links with fescue and sea wind. Three courses, three pressure types on one variable: the ability to control ball height. A distance-restricted ball typically spins less, flies lower and rolls more on landing. On Aronimink's tiered greens, three extra yards of roll can send a ball off the putting surface. At Shinnecock, three extra yards can start a ball down a slope. At Birkdale, a lower flight is less exposed to crosswind. The new rule does not just take distance; it redistributes risk by course type.

5. Tournament-system layer: points, exemptions and the OWGR axis

The Official World Golf Ranking runs a time-weighted average with a two-year minimum divisor. An event's points depend on field quality, not on the event's name. That structure produces an effect few readers of the ranking notice: a player can fall by not playing, while another climbs by playing weaker but less competitive fields. The structural bias is not an organising body's fault; it is the arithmetic of a fixed formula applied to a schedule that has already changed.

LIV Golf withdrew its application for world-ranking recognition in March 2026. Its events have since earned no ranking points. The data consequence is concrete: a full-time LIV player accumulates no ranking points and must rely on special exemptions, still-valid major champion exemptions, or open qualifying to reach the majors. In my model this is not a historical variable but an institutional one, and institutional variables do not follow a normal distribution.

The four majors run different field mechanisms. The Masters has the smallest field, under 100, with tight invite criteria. The PGA Championship has the largest, with a significant share reserved for PGA of America professionals. The US Open is the most open, with roughly half the field arriving through qualifying. The Open runs the widest international qualifying system. Those mechanisms produce different statistical distributions: in a compressed field on a course prepared to the limit, putting carries a higher weight in the total; in a broad field under volatile weather, approach play carries more. That is why I do not run one model across four majors. I run four models with four weight sets.

7. Rules and equipment layer: four changes to model

Ball distance limit. The largest change. Model Local Rule G-4 alters the test conditions — 125 mph clubhead speed, 11 degrees launch, 2,200 rpm spin, with the limit still at 317 yards — for elite competition from January 2026 and for all golfers from January 2030.

Green-reading book limits. Since 2026, printed green-reading materials have been capped in size and scale. A small change with measurable consequences for players who leaned heavily on books.

Caddie alignment ban. From January 1, 2026, Rule 10.2b(4) formally banned a caddie from standing in the area behind the player to help aim once the player has taken his stance. A technical change, not a moral one, and one that feeds directly into approach-play numbers.

Pace-of-play policy. The PGA Tour tightened its pace policy from 2026 with slow-play penalties. A psychological variable, indirectly measurable through the late-round performance of players frequently warned for slow play.

Together these four changes create a competitive environment unlike any in the past two decades.

11. The contrarian angle: correlation is not causation

Players with the best putting weeks do not usually win. I have re-tested that pattern and it holds. The usual explanation is variance: a hot putting week is luck. That is partly right, but it leads to a conclusion I consider false — that putting carries no predictive value. My data says otherwise. Season-level Strokes Gained: Putting is far more stable than week-level. A player who putts well for a season has a skill; a player who putts well for a week has an event. Confusing those two levels is the biggest blind spot in golf analysis today.

The same applies to the ball rule. For twelve months, the correlation between changing equipment and results will be strong, and much of it will be noise reflecting adaptation speed rather than skill. A second, more important contrarian point: the biggest beneficiaries may not be short hitters but players who are elite from 150 to 180 yards. When everyone loses 15 yards, most approaches get half a club longer, and the best mid-iron players gain relative to the best sub-120-yard wedge players, who lose exactly the distance they were best at.
